Published in 2021, this edition is uniquely positioned to address the seismic shifts in global supply chains caused by the COVID-19 pandemic. Previous editions focused on the efficiency of lean systems; however, the 2021 context necessitated a discussion on resilience and risk management. The text explores the delicate balance between cutting costs and building redundancy. It delves into the strategic importance of sourcing, logistics, and the bullwhip effect with a fresh perspective on how digital connectivity can either mitigate or exacerbate these issues. By highlighting the importance of transparency and agility, the book prepares readers to manage operations in an environment defined by uncertainty.
